My recent trip to Glacier National Park was one of the best moose trips I have ever had.  I have never seen so many moose at one time, let alone got so many good picture opportunities of them.  If you listen carefully in some of the videos, you will hear elk bugling in the background.  The elk would answer me when I bugled them, but nothing got them as riled up as a bull moose grunting.  I took literally hundreds of pictures of moose, here are some of my favorites as well as many videos (I have more to upload later as well). 

I was blessed to see a cow and a calf as well as a lone cow many times throughout the trip. Here are some of the better pictures of cows and calves.  I one time had the calf run by me through the water at less than 2 feet, I got wet from the splashes.

There are also three bulls in the area.  I only got pictures of two of them, luckily, the one I did not see was only a spike.  Both bulls were rutting and grunting the entire week.  The smaller of the two was constantly following cows around and trying to court them.  The cows always turned them down.  I had both bulls walk by me at less than 15 yards.

I also got some great pictures of a really nice bull one day.  He came out to the lake grunting the whole way and just walked right by us and across the lake.  He really got the bull elk riled up.  One of the elk kept bugling and grunting at him from in the trees, unluckily he never came out into the open.  I know nothing about scoring moose, what does this big guy score?  What about the smaller bull for comparison?
